button with icon bootstrap 5

You can use it like this: Some future-friendly styles are included to disable all, Designed and built with all the love in the world by the. While Bootstrap doesnt include an icon set by default, we do have our own comprehensive icon library called Bootstrap Icons. Once unpublished, all posts by behainguyen will become hidden and only accessible to themselves. Default Buttons Note that elements do not support the disabled In font awesome, buttons are implemented using combination of and : Is there a better way? Danger However, you can still force the same active appearance with .active (and include the aria-pressed="true" attribute) should you need to replicate the state programmatically. Bootstrap 5 provides different styles of buttons: Basic Similar to the example above, youll likely need some utilities though to space things properly. 5 principles of readable code: KISS | YAGNI | DRY | BDU | Occam's razor, "https://cdn.jsdelivr.net/npm/bootstrap@5.1.3/dist/css/bootstrap.min.css", "sha384-1BmE4kWBq78iYhFldvKuhfTAU6auU8tT94WrHftjDbrCEXSU1oBoqyl2QvZ6jIW3", "https://cdn.jsdelivr.net/npm/bootstrap-icons@1.9.1/font/bootstrap-icons.css", url("./fonts/bootstrap-icons.woff2?8d200481aa7f02a2d63a331fc782cfaf"), url("./fonts/bootstrap-icons.woff?8d200481aa7f02a2d63a331fc782cfaf"), https://behai-nguyen.github.io/demo/042/bootstrap-5-button-icon.html. An animated arrow icon is at the right side of the button which indicates 'Click Me'. Buttons Bootstrap 5 Button component Responsive Buttons built with Bootstrap 5. Since, the <input> is an empty element, we cannot place the icon HTML directly inside the input button like we do with the buttons created using the <button> element.. Also, if you want to support our friends from Tailwind Elements you can also check out the Latest Collection of free Hand picked Pure Html Bootstrap Buttons Examples for you to use in your projects. Finally, add text to the button. Bootstraps .button styles can be applied to other elements, such as elements that are used to trigger in-page functionality (like collapsing content), rather than linking to new pages or sections within the current page, these links should be given a role="button" to appropriately convey their purpose to assistive technologies such as screen readers. First make sure you have added Bootstrap Icon library. Fancy larger or smaller buttons? Bootstrap 5 Buttons with Icons Success Cancel Bookmark Camera Left Right Thumbs Up Thumbs Down Refresh Trash. While using W3Schools, you agree to have read and accepted our. <!-- Using Icons in Bootstrap 5. Connect with us on Facebook and Twitter for the latest updates. Use Bootstraps custom button styles for actions in forms, dialogs, and more with support for multiple sizes, states, and more. Is it realistic for an actor to act in four movies in six months? Here weve taken our previous responsive example and added some flex utilities and a margin utility on the button to right align the buttons when theyre no longer stacked. https://behai-nguyen.github.io/, Master of Applied Science in Computer Science, RMIT, Victoria, Australia, Top 8 Paid Open Source Programs To Apply To in2023. There are two buttons in the design. Feel free to use them or any other icon set in your project. Make buttons look inactive by adding the disabled boolean attribute to any